Treadmill Training and Whole-body Vibration for Children with Cerebral Palsy

This study is looking at how treadmill training (TT) and whole-body vibration (WBV) might help children with cerebral palsy (CP). Researchers want to see if adding a single session of WBV to a single session of TT can improve walking and reduce muscle stiffness in the legs. You might be able to join if you are between 6 and 17 years old, have spastic CP, and can walk independently (GMFCS level I, II, or III). The study will measure changes in your walking speed, step length, and knee movement right after the interventions. This study plans to include 20 participants, but its current status is unclear.

Study design
This interventional study plans to enroll 20 participants. It compares the effects of treadmill training alone versus treadmill training combined with whole-body vibration.
What's involved
You would complete a 10-minute treadmill walk, rest for 15 minutes, and then either do another treadmill walk or a 12-minute whole-body vibration session followed by a treadmill walk.

Eligibility criteria

Inclusion

a medical diagnosis of spastic CP
a GMFCS level of I, II, or III
age of 6-17 years at the time of data collection

Exclusion

history of musculoskeletal injury within the past 3 months
history of Botox injections to the lower extremities within the past 3 months
history of significant cardiac abnormalities and/or uncontrolled seizures
any cognitive or behavioral issues that prevent the subject from safely following instructions while walking on the treadmill
  • Overground gait walking speedimmediately after intervention

    Measured in m/s from kinematic motion capture data

  • Overground gait step lengthimmediately after intervention

    Measured in cm from kinematic motion capture data

  • Overground gait dynamic knee range of motionimmediately after intervention

    Measured in degrees from kinematic motion capture data

  • Overground gait dynamic ankle range of motionimmediately after intervention

    Measured in degrees from kinematic motion capture data

  • Overground gait muscle activity as measured by electromyographic sensorsimmediately after intervention

    integrated area per gait cycle at the following muscles: biceps femoris, vastus lateralis, lateral gastrocnemius, tibialis anterior

  • Lower extremity spasticity as measured by the Modified Tardieu Testimmediately after intervention

    including R1 and R2 joint angles as well as qualitative score
